将近似技术应用于船体型线优化中,构建便于求解的近似模型,用以代替CFD数值求解,能有效提高船型优化的效率,缩短优化时间。如何构建高精度的近似模型关系到优化结果是否可靠,而样本点的选取方式是影响近似模型精度的重要因素之一。论文首先阐述了拉丁超立方设计的选点原理。其次,针对均匀设计存在的难点,提出了大试验次数均匀设计表的构造方法。然后,以数学测试函数为例,论述了两种选点方法的适用性。最后,以国际标模KCS为例,建立了船舶阻力性能的近似模型,并进行了精度检验。

An approximation technology is applied to hull form optimization for constructing approximate model that facilitates to computation and can be used to replace CFD tools. This technology can significantly improve the efficiency of hull form optimization and shorten the time period of optimization. High precision of the approximation model determines a reliable optimization result, while selection of sample points is one of the important factors affecting the accuracy of the model. In this paper, firstly the principle of Latin hypercube sampling is expounded. Secondly, the method of uniform design for large sample points is proposed. Then, the applicability of these two methods is discussed based on mathematical function. Finally, an approximate model of resistance performance for the international standard ship model is established, and the accuracy of this approximate model is examined.
